Where is the window relay switch on a 97 Ford Explorer?

The 1997 Ford Explorer has a 30 amp maxi-fuse in location # 10 of the power distribution box in the engine compartment for power windows/locks/seats. There is a relay in the box under the dash to the right of the steering wheel.


Where is the fuel pump relay for a 1997 Ford Explorer located?

The fuel pump relay for your 1997 Ford Explorer - is the # 6 relay in the power distribution box in your engine compartment

Your power windows on your 1997 Ford Explorer stopped working checked the fuses they are all good what else could it be?

Have you checked the WINDOW LOCK button on the drivers door armrest ( just a thought ) Also , I was looking at the 1997 Ford Explorer Owner Guide and it shows that there is a 30 amp maxi fuse ( # 10 ) in the Power Distribution Box ( the P D Box is " live " ) located in the engine compartment which is for the Power Windows / Power Locks / Power Seats
